雖然這篇javascript複製陣列鄉民發文沒有被收入到精華區:在javascript複製陣列這個話題中,我們另外找到其它相關的精選爆讚文章
[爆卦]javascript複製陣列是什麼?優點缺點精華區懶人包
你可能也想看看
搜尋相關網站
-
#1[JS] 複製Array / Object 的幾種常用方法(深/淺拷貝) - Eudora
記錄JavaScript 中,複製array / object 的常見方法,以及深淺拷貝的差異。 # 先備知識:. JS 資料型態( Data Types )x7.
-
#2透過複製陣列理解JS 的淺拷貝與深拷貝- JavaScript - Askie's ...
注意事項:對多維陣列來說,這不是安全的複製。因為array/object 是 copied by reference 而不是 by value 。 [ O ] 基於剛剛的程式碼,單維陣列 ...
-
#3JS 以陣列Array 的複製談型別(下) - iT 邦幫忙
拿它來做什麼? 再決定。 在複製陣列之前,先理解了JavaScript 會依資料型別Primitive type(基本型別)和Non-primitive ...
-
#4js複製物件和陣列的幾種方法- IT閱讀 - ITREAD01.COM
js 中的基本資料型別可以直接進行復制. 例如: var str1 = '123456' var str2 = str1 console.log(str2) //123456 str1 = '123' console.log(str2) // ...
-
#5javascript 陣列以及物件的深拷貝(複製陣列或複製物件)的方法
在js中,陣列和物件的複製如果使用 = 號來進行復制,那只是淺拷貝。如下圖演示:. 如上, arr 的修改,會影響 arr2 的值,這顯然在絕 ...
-
#6複製陣列問題(Javascript) | Leon的程式心得 - 點部落
那到底要如何複製陣列,又不影響原陣列呢? 首先回想一下,基本型別(Primitive Type)跟物件(Object)兩者有什麼差異呢. 基本型別是Number ...
-
#7Array.prototype.slice() - JavaScript - MDN Web Docs
slice() 方法會回傳一個新陣列物件,為原陣列選擇之begin 至end(不含end)部分的淺拷貝(shallow copy)。而原本的陣列將不會被修改。
-
#8JavaScript 淺拷貝(Shallow Copy) 與深拷貝(Deep Copy)
在JavaScript 的世界裡有基本型別與物件型別兩種定義。 ... 牽一髮動全身的概念,所以當我們在複製物件或陣列時,基本上都是使用函式的方式去做處理。
-
#9js陣列物件複製拷貝不改變原來的值,深拷貝 - IT人
js陣列 ,物件複製拷貝,深拷貝,按值傳遞陣列拷貝方法1 es6擴充套件運算子let arr1 = [1, 2, 3], arr2 = [...arr1];arr2.pop(); console.log(arr1) ...
-
#10按值複製陣列- JAVASCRIPT _程式人生
【JAVASCRIPT】按值複製陣列. 2020-10-22 JAVASCRIPT. 將JavaScript中的陣列複製到另一個數組時: var arr1 = ['a','b','c']; var arr2 = arr1; arr2.push('d'); //Now, ...
-
#11透過複製陣列理解JS 的淺拷貝與深拷貝- JavaScript - GitHub
透過複製陣列理解JS 的淺拷貝與深拷貝- JavaScript - Askie's Coding Life #88. Open. askiebaby opened this issue on Sep 28, 2020 · 2 comments.
-
#12Javascript的深淺拷貝原來是這樣的| 七日打卡
let a = 1; let b = a; a = 3; console.log(a, b); // 3 1 複製程式碼. 引用資料型別. 而對於引用資料型別,從一個變數拷貝到另一個變數,本質是拷貝 ...
-
#13陣列· 從ES6開始的JavaScript學習生活
深拷貝(deep copy)反而容易理解,它是真正複製出另一個完全獨立的陣列。不過,深拷貝是一種高花費的執行程序,所以對於效率與精確,甚至能包含的特殊物件範圍都需要考慮。
-
#14JavaScript Array 陣列操作方法大全( 含ES6 )
陣列 的操作是JavaScript 裡很重要也很常用到的技巧,這篇文章一次整理常用的陣列操作 ... copyWithin() 能複製陣列中的某些元素,並將它們放到並取同一個陣列指定的 ...
-
#15[JS] JavaScript 陣列(Array) | PJCHENder 未整理筆記
Array.isArray(obj) // 檢驗是否為陣列 const arrCopy = [...arr] // 複製陣列(copy array)@ airbnb 4.3 const nodes = [.
-
#16JavaScript 用...array 和slice 簡單展開淺拷貝陣列 - 學習雜記- 痞 ...
slice() 括弧內不給值或是給0都可以當成簡易的複製陣列. const newArray = firstArray.slice(); console.log(newArray);. //[1,2,3] ...
-
#17JavaScript-淺拷貝(Shallow Copy) VS 深拷貝(Deep Copy)
複製 一個新的陣列. var animals = ['ant', 'bison', 'camel', 'duck', 'elephant']; console.log(animals.slice(2));
-
#18JavaScript中十种一步拷贝数组的方法
该数组必须要从下一个迭代函数的执行后被返回出来。 同样的,处理对象和数组的时候是引用而不是值复制。 7、Array.slice(浅拷贝).
-
#19JavaScript 陣列或物件的複製 - 鴻廣資訊
矩陣或物件直接用等號,通常是用傳址來參照,沒辦法擁有獨立的記憶體。 這時候需要自行複製一份來玩:. 需要jQuery 1.1.4 以上,語法jQuery.extend( [deep], target, ...
-
#20Cheatsheet for Array Methods - JavaScript 陣列方法大全
複製陣列 中的元素,並置換原始陣列中原本的元素。 參數. 有三個參數:. 第一個是要置換的位置(必填)。 第二個是複製起點 ...
-
#21[javascript] 複製(clone)一個陣列@ 我是小咖工程師 - 隨意窩
prototype不知道是什麼嗎? 很簡單就是原型啦~javascript 允許我們針對他的原型去擴充method,array 陣列這玩意對javascript也是一個object 所以我們 ...
-
#22J 筆記- Clone an Array
複製陣列 及資料,不管在什麼語言當中,都是很常用到的方式,在了解如何複製 ... 重新認識JavaScript: Day 05 JavaScript 是「傳值」或「傳址」?
-
#23javascript复制数组的三种方式 - 知乎专栏
由此验证,arr2是arr1的复制品。当然这种方式比较繁琐。 2.ES6的Array.from(). ES6的Array.from 方法用于将两类对象转 ...
-
#24Array 和WriteOnlyArray (C++/CX) | Microsoft Docs
下一個範例顯示如何將JavaScript 中配置的陣列傳遞至讀取此陣列的C++ 函式。 JavaScript 複製. //JavaScript function button2_click() { var obj ...
-
#25javascript中陣列和物件的深拷貝實現方法 - w3c學習教程
javascript 中陣列和物件的深拷貝實現方法,在js中,陣列和物件的複製如果使用號來進行復制,那只是淺拷貝。如下圖演示如上,arr的修改,會影響arr2的值 ...
-
#26物件的繼承(三)--複製屬性的第二種方法 - 維克的煩惱
不過要注意的是,Javascript在複製物件或是陣列時,會有一種淺層複製(shallow copy)的慣例。所謂的淺層複製意思就是說,對於物件與陣列而言,只有參考 ...
-
#27「JS30紀錄&心得」14 - JavaScript References VS Copying
為了避免Call by refrence時會去異動到原本的陣列, 就要先把原本的陣列做一次複製,用剛才的範例來做, 有以下幾種方法:
-
#28如何在JavaScript 中合併兩個陣列而不出現重複的情況 - Delft ...
假設我們有兩個陣列 arrayA 和 arrayB ,我們想把它們合併到 arrayC 中。 JavaScript. javascriptCopy var arrayA = ["Java ...
-
#29Js複製物件/克隆物件Js淺拷貝與深拷貝淺拷貝和 ... - tw511教學網
Js複製 物件/克隆物件Js淺拷貝與深拷貝淺拷貝和深拷貝的實現方法. ... 這種方法雖然可以實現陣列或物件深拷貝,但不能處理常式和正則,因為這兩者 ...
-
#30深入JavaScript基礎之深淺拷貝 - ITW01
JS 中的淺拷貝與深拷貝,只是針對複雜資料型別(Object,Array)的複製問題。淺拷貝與深拷貝都可以實現在已有物件上再生出一份的作用。
-
#31javascript將陣列合併(merge) - XYZ的筆記本
javascript 要將陣列合併,可以使用concat 方法, 範例如下 ... var a = this .concat(); //使用concat()再複製一份陣列,避免影響原陣列.
-
#32[JS作品]JS30系列14 - JavaScript References vs Copying JS中 ...
物件的複製也是類似參照型別,所以跟陣列類似,有以下幾個方式處理:. Object.assign · Spread syntax. 但是物件裡面尚有巢狀物件的情形需要考慮, ...
-
#33Javascript自學筆記(6)
JSON 用JavaScript物件所表示的電子交換格式, ... 深複製(deep copy). 完全複製㇐份全新的物件或陣列,雙方的記憶體位置都不相同 ...
-
#34[ 筆記] JavaScript - 01 陣列 - 程式導師計畫第四期學習紀錄
[ 筆記] JavaScript - 01 陣列 ... 欲把arr1(稀疏陣列)中的可用元素複製到arr2 var arr1 = [1, 2, undefined, null, 3, 4, 5, , ,]; var arr2 ...
-
#35「JavaScript 30」學習筆記(十四)
目標. 了解JavaScript 的「By Value」和「By Reference」觀念。 ... 的値改變,另一個陣列的値也會跟著改變。 要複製一個陣列,可以使用以下方法: ...
-
#36[javascript] 複製內容至剪貼簿| 文章 - DeTools 工具死神
document.execCommand( "copy" );. 那如果想要複製的內容不在頁面上,可能是靠程式產生的或是網址之類的 ...
-
#37JavaScript 的深拷貝和淺拷貝 - w3c菜鳥教程
JavaScript 的深拷貝和淺拷貝,關於淺拷貝,按照常理理解, ... extend() 是基於物件的,如果是陣列,slice(0)和concat() 其實也只複製了一層(.
-
#38[Javascript] Object 常用方法 - 晴耕雨讀
複製 物件; 合併物件. Object.entries(). 取得物件的Key-Value Map; 配合Array 的解構賦值迭代物件. Object.values(). 取得物件屬性陣列.
-
#39[Javascript] 陣列、陣列的操作@新精讚
Javascript 的陣列操作:宣告、取值、賦值、插入或移除項目,檢查KEY、檢查是否為陣列等等. ... 複製連結 [Javascript] 陣列、陣列的操作@新精讚 ...
-
#40javascript中的深拷貝和淺拷貝 - IT145.com
資料複製是我們程式設計中經常會使用到的技術,對於普通數值資料來說, ... 數值,字元串,布爾值,undefined,null為原始資料類型,而陣列和物件則 ...
-
#41JavaScript陣列的常用方法 - 程序員學院
JavaScript陣列 的常用方法,1 push 作用在陣列末尾新增項引數要新增的項, ... 引數:(n)從索引n開始複製到陣列末尾,(n,m)從索引n開始複製到索引m, ...
-
#42JavaScript陣列copyWithin()方法 - w3bai.com
複製 前兩個數組元素的最後兩個數組元素:. var fruits = ["Banana", "Orange", "Apple", "Mango"]; fruits.copyWithin(2,0);. 水果的結果將是:.
-
#43Javascript 去除的array中空白或是null元素 - CyuBlog
Javascript 去除的array中空白或是null元素. Thursday, October 10, 2019 | Thursday, October 10, 2019 | Javascript ... Array, Object的複製 · Javascript 去除 ...
-
#44js 数组拷贝 - 掘金
js 数组拷贝方法整理. ... let fc1 = Array.from(array1);复制代码 ... 看一看原生JavaScript中提供的一些复制方法究竟是深拷贝还是浅拷贝以及动手 ...
-
#45淺克隆一個陣列| 他山教程,只選擇最優質的自學材料
這稱為內建的JavaScript Array.prototype.slice 方法。如果你將引數傳遞給 slice ,你可以獲得更復雜的行為來建立只有部分陣列的淺克隆,但出於我們的 ...
-
#46JavaScript30 - 大专栏
JavaScript 參考與複製的差別 ... 此時必須透過特殊方法來複製一份原值來解決。 ... 從類陣列(array-like)或是可迭代(iterable)物件建立一個新的Array 實體 ...
-
#47JavaScript 基礎介紹陣列Array與物件Object - ucamc
JavaScript 基礎介紹陣列Array與物件Object ... output: { name: 'Tank' } 此方法是複製屬性而不是整個物件```js const person = { name: 'Andy' }; ...
-
#4830 天Javascript 從入門到進階:陣列 - 劉安齊
JS 的陣列可以放入任何東西,而且可以是不同東西。 ... 我們先複製 arr1 給 arr2 ,然後改了 arr1 第0 個元素,結果 arr2 的第0 個元素也被改了。
-
#49ES6 -- 新內建方法取代舊內建方法: 複製物件屬性 - 關於程式的 ...
dst[k] = src1[k]; // 將src1這陣列的值複製到dst物件上 }); Object.keys(src2).forEach(function(k) { dst[k] = src2[k]; // 將src2這陣列的值複製 ...
-
#50什麼是在JavaScript中部分複製對象數組的最優雅的方式- 優文庫
我有兩個對象數組。 arrayOne包含的項目類型的myObject1: var myObject1 = { Id: 1, //key params: { weight: 52, price: 100 }, name:
-
#51Array concat() 陣列合併- JavaScript (JS) 教學Tutorial - Fooish ...
JavaScript Array concat() (陣列合併). 陣列(array)的concat() 方法可以用來合併兩個不同的陣列變成一個新陣列。 語法:
-
#52維修人員|義丞有限公司|新北市汐止區|2021/10/27|1111 ...
... 的程式語言JavaScript 為核心,學習相關熱門的函式庫jQuery 及框架Vue.js,後端 ... 在介紹函數對圖像的處理前,先展示函數對數值、陣列的處理,方便學員從數值的 ...
-
#53我們與黑洞、躁鬱症的距離?! - Rti 中央廣播電臺
本周最夯話題即是台灣的驕傲在2018年正式加入「事件視界望遠鏡」全球陣列觀測計畫,以獲取黑洞影像為首要目標,人類史上第一張黑洞照片,是由8座電波 ...
-
#54GTA Spano積木模型衝破LEGO最速世界紀錄 - Yahoo奇摩汽車
相信不用小編多說,Land Rover這支以「全地形能力」聞名世界的品牌,旗下陣列中都是以SUV為主要產品陣列,在汽車工業蓬勃發展的初期, ...
-
#55angular:在typescript中建立一个陣列的克隆- arrays - Codebug
在javascript中克隆陣列和物件的語法不同.迟早,每个人都会以艰难的方式了解差異 ... spread操作符也適用於物件,但它只会執行浅層複製(第一層子級).
-
#56JavaScript網頁設計與TensorFlow.js人工智慧應用教本(電子書)
在陣列使用擴展運算子:Ch12_1_5.html 在陣列使用擴展運算子可以展開陣列元素,例如:陣列 ... 我們也可以使用擴展運算子來複製陣列,如下所示: let arr4 = [...arr1]; ...
-
#57F-35軍售對手「獅鷲」輸在2大罩門- 軍事
除了增加武器掛架外,它還加強融合來自「主動電子掃瞄陣列」(AESA)雷達、電戰系統,紅外線搜索追蹤系統和更先進資料鏈的資料。
-
#58看透JavaScript:原理、方法與實踐 - Google 圖書結果
第二個參數start不可省略,表示複製元素的起始位置。第三個參數可省略,表示複製元素的結束位置,默認值為陣列的長度,例如下面的例子。 console.log( [1, 2, 3, 4, 5].
-
#59Vue.js 2前端漸進式建構框架實戰應用|完美搭配Bootstrap 4與Firebase(電子書)
首先,將 javascript_objectliteral01.js 複製為 ... 的「鍵」與「值」的輸出資料: 11-9 Array 物件常見的方法陣列(array)是一個經常使用的資料結構(data structure), ...
-
#60Effective JavaScript 中文版(電子書) - 第 75 頁 - Google 圖書結果
... false nonstrict("unmodified"); // true 結果就是,修改 arguments 物件的動作變得比較安全。不過要避免仍是很簡單,只要先把它的元素複製到一個真正的陣列中即可。
-
#61【亂亂寫筆記】JavaScript - 陣列與陣列內元素比對 - 文科少女 ...
貼心小提醒!! 因為是亂亂寫筆記,真的就是純紀錄之前實作時, 如何解決曾經卡住過的問題,所以主要都是解決問題的方式為主, 不會有太多詳細說明。
-
#62跟著實務學習HTML5、CSS3、JavaScript、jQuery、jQuery Mobile、Bootstrap ...
Step03 複製 App使用的圖檔將書附光碟 ch17 資料夾的 images 內的所有夜市圖檔 ... 在下一個步驟在 index.js 中會使用 for 迴圈,將夜市陣列資料加入到 ListView 中。
-
#63RUGJ 病毒 (.rugj 文件)— 解密和刪除工具
請注意,也可以將其直接複製到剪貼板,並在需要時將其粘貼到電子郵件或消息中。 嘗試還原.rugj文件失敗後,Emsisoft解密器可能會顯示不同的消息: ...
javascript複製陣列 在 コバにゃんチャンネル Youtube 的最讚貼文
javascript複製陣列 在 大象中醫 Youtube 的最佳解答
javascript複製陣列 在 大象中醫 Youtube 的最讚貼文